Is perhaps DesignOps still in the "What" phase while DevOps is at the "How" phase π€
Is perhaps DesignOps still in the "What" phase while DevOps is at the "How" phase π€
π I've been wondering how to look at DesignOps through the perspective of how DevOps has become
We're starting to write a blog about a great thing my team are working on. An accessibility annotations library for Figma for the GOVUK design system. We'll be open-sourcing it,Β so let me know if you'd like to try it before weΒ put it out into the wild. It's a brilliant piece of work!
Definitely up for trying it out and help out with feedback β¨
When not defining a SSOT, how do you handle variations coming from both sides? Do you keep both in sync at all times, or is diff acceptable?
π Feedback is welcome!
β¨ Planning to add more options to export to other platforms
π¦ It currently transforms your tokens to CSS and outputs it as an Github Action artifact
If you wanna transform your β¨ Tokens Studio tokens without having to mingle with code yourself, try out github.com/marketplace/...
nektos/act - is saving me a ton of time by running github actions locally. @vscode.dev @github.com, if only this could run directly on the editor π
I've been wanting to shift my focus to #DesignSystems full time. That's the reason getds.pro became a thing. I'm looking for cool projects where I could use my experience and passion in bridging the gap between design and development by enhancing product teams with design system tooling and ops.
Accessibility Settings Alt text Require alt text before posting (toggled ON)
Folks please donβt forget to ALT your images! The more new folks show up here the lower the adoption of ALT is and thatβs a bummer cause it means not all Bluesky users can enjoy your images!
Hereβs how to turn on prompts to remind you to ALT:
Considering remote from NL?
#ComponentLibrary #ReusableComponents #DesignPatterns #UIKit #DesignKit
π Friendly reminder: Our #DesignSystems #accessibility meetup is taking place tomorrow! See you online?
Are your Design System components accessible!?
Let's find out! βοΈ
We've invited two leading accessibility experts to review your components!
Join our casual & friendly event π
lu.ma/srv55eoj
Tailwind β‘οΈ
Tired:
@media (min-width: 500px) { }
Wired:
@media (width >= 500px) { }
Even better when you need to double up like:
@media (500px <= width <= 1000px) { }
Took a minute but I got my brain to flip over to the new way. Also easier to avoid weird 1px gaps.
Good article:
cssence.com/2024/superio...
6. You Wanted This
Asking me to roast you? Bold move. Let me guess, you thought Iβd go easy. Nah. DS Pro is just getting started, but right now, itβs less pro and more meh. But hey, youβve got Zod and dreamsβmaybe thatβs enough?
5. Meaningful Work
Your UX expertise is impeccableβfor the two people whoβve tried your tool. Maybe one day, theyβll write a heartfelt testimonial like, βIt wasβ¦ fine, I guess?β Truly a revolutionary approach to helping someone... someday.
4. Nature Lover?
You claim to love hiking, climbing, and the great outdoors, yet here you areβindoors, working on GitHub integrations. The mountains are calling, Tomas, but youβre like, βNot now, Figma sync needs me.β
3. DS Proβs Smash Hit
16 sign-ups, zero engagementβDS Pro is killing it! Nothing screams success like creating a product people look at and immediately close. Maybe βdesign system in one clickβ is so advanced, your users are still Googling what a design system is.
2. Your βCommunitiesβ
Your Discord and Reddit are like exclusive clubsβwith no one on the guest list. Bet your bot is lonely in there. Who needs users when youβve got a dream, right? Meanwhile, Redditβs just sitting there, gathering dust like a forgotten attic.
1. β¬50 Sales King
Youβre launching a business with a revenue plan that wouldnβt even cover a Netflix subscription. Bold strategy! At least youβll be the poster child for βstarting from the bottomβ when youβre rolling in eurosβ¦ if your sales ever hit triple digits.
Oh, Tomas, you brave, design-system-slinging, JavaScript-wielding, accessibility-preaching warrior of the digital frontier! Letβs dive in:
Me: Roast me based on our conversations. Don't hold back.
ChatGPT: π
Thatβs why you gotta abide by the Pac-Man rule. Never form a full circle when having a conversation in a group; always leave a βmouthβ open so new people can join.
Youβll be amazed how well it works.
Experimenting with a design token editor for storybook π
"#DesignSystems is big company word"
That's something I don't stand behind. I get the value of a design system as a solo developer.
I feel like there's an hidden interest in keeping design systems and its ecosystem as complex and technical as possible, like a cool kids club.
We need to do better
I've been building getds.pro β an open-source design system engine to help you create, maintain, and scale your design system.
π Sync tokens with your codebase.
π¦ Soon: tokens in NPM packages for easy adoption.
The goal is to make design systems universal and accessible for all. Feedback is welcome!